Market context

The match is a best-of-three League of Legends series between Hanwha Life Esports Challengers and Kiwoom DRX Challengers in the LCK Challengers League trial group, and the market resolves on the live winner if it is played as scheduled. A 0% YES price is best read as a *hard no* on Hanwha Life rather than a neutral coin flip: the same pairing has already produced mixed recent results in 2026, with one earlier LCK CL meeting won by Hanwha Life and another by Kiwoom DRX, while broader head-to-head pages also show the teams trading wins across prior Challengers events.[1][5][12][14]

For accessibility, the relevant regulatory lens is straightforward: a Poland-style or Korean domestic esports market may still matter commercially, but for German users the key question is whether a venue is subject to the Glücksspielstaatsvertrag (GlüStV). If the operator is not licensed for Germany, access can be constrained by geoblocking, payment screening, or account checks; a “no-KYC up to $1,500” policy usually means identity verification is deferred until cumulative activity or withdrawals cross that threshold, not that the market is fully anonymous. In the United States, the CFTC’s reach is most relevant if the contract sits on a platform taking U.S. persons or offering event contracts that could be viewed as derivatives; that is an access and enforcement issue, not a view on match quality.

The main catalysts are practical rather than strategic: final start time confirmation, whether the series actually launches inside the stated window, and whether the bracket or trial-group schedule changes. Public fixtures currently place the series on 7 August 2026 around 05:00 UTC, which is consistent with the market’s listed timing and leaves little room for drift, but any postponement, server-side delay, or format change would matter more than pre-match form because a cancelled or materially delayed match would not settle to either side.[1][7][10]
